Dive into the avant-garde world of John Blum with his 2009 album, "In the Shade of Sun." This captivating release is a testament to Blum's mastery of free jazz, showcasing his unique ability to push boundaries and redefine musical norms. Collaborating with the legendary Sunny Murray on drums and the incomparable William Parker on bass, Blum crafts a sonic landscape that is as thought-provoking as it is melodically rich.
The album unfolds over six tracks, each a journey into the depths of improvisational brilliance. From the hauntingly beautiful "In the Shade of Sun - Part 1" to the introspective "Misanthrope's Dream," Blum and his cohorts explore a range of emotions and musical textures. The title track, split into two parts, serves as a bookend to this immersive experience, drawing listeners in and leaving them in a state of contemplative awe.
Released under the Ecstatic Peace! label, "In the Shade of Sun" is a must-listen for fans of avant-garde and free jazz. The album's 53-minute duration is a testament to the depth and complexity of the music, offering a rich tapestry of sounds that will captivate and inspire.
